The cheapest way to get from Ballyshannon to Navan is to drive which costs €25 - €40 and takes 1h 54m.
The fastest way to get from Ballyshannon to Navan is to drive which takes 1h 54m and costs €25 - €40.
No, there is no direct bus from Ballyshannon to Navan. However, there are services departing from Ballyshannon and arriving at Navan R147 via Cavan Bus Stn.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 46m.
The distance between Ballyshannon and Navan is 159 km. The road distance is 153.7 km.
The best way to get from Ballyshannon to Navan without a car is to bus which takes 3h 46m and costs €30 - €45.
It takes approximately 3h 46m to get from Ballyshannon to Navan, including transfers.
Ballyshannon to Navan bus services, operated by Expressway (Bus Éireann), depart from Ballyshannon station.
Ballyshannon to Navan bus services, operated by Expressway (Bus Éireann), arrive at Cavan Bus Stn station.
Yes, the driving distance between Ballyshannon to Navan is 154 km. It takes approximately 1h 54m to drive from Ballyshannon to Navan.
